Stadtwerke Gießen is expanding its product range to include two attractive green electricity tariffs. The electrical energy for the two new tariffs comes 100 per cent from European hydropower.

For many years now, Stadtwerke Gießen (SWG) has been supplying its private and commercial customers with Giessen green electricity, i.e. electrical energy that comes 40 per cent from its own combined heat and power plants and thus significantly reduces the impact on the climate. SWG is now offering its customers the opportunity to do even more for the climate. For Gießener Grünstrom Plus and Gießener Grünstrom Plus Drive, the two new purely green electricity tariffs, SWG has secured corresponding quantities from certified European hydropower. "Guarantees of origin guarantee that the green electricity we sell is actually generated in hydropower plants and is only sold once," emphasises Ina Weller, SWG company spokesperson.

Small differences
Giessener Grünstrom Plus is the ideal choice for anyone who wants to reduce their household's carbon footprint. Of course, this also includes charging any electric car you may already have. After all, it is well known that such a vehicle is only really CO2-free when it is powered by genuine green electricity. Just how important this aspect is can be seen from the recently launched state subsidy for private wallboxes: The condition for payment of the subsidy is operation with certified green electricity. "Both products fulfil the requirements of the KfW 440 funding programme," adds Ina Weller. This means that anyone who has an appropriate wallbox installed and uses Giessener Grünstrom Plus receives the state subsidy for their own charging station.
This is exactly where Giessener Grünstrom Plus Drive comes into play. This pure charging electricity tariff can only be combined with a household electricity tariff and requires a second meter, but offers particularly favourable conditions. Also important to know: The special offer for e-mobilists is only available in the area covered by SWG subsidiary Mittelhessen Netz GmbH (MIT.N).
